A Sample Day at the School of Theatre
A typical schedule may look like the following:
[Students will also take a trip to NYC to see a Broadway Show as part of their program.]
Time | Activity Description |
---|---|
8:00am | Breakfast in the SUNY Delhi Dining Hall |
8:45-9:35am | Warm-ups and Movement |
9:45-11:45am | Voice |
12:00-1:00pm | Lunch and Free Time (Practice, Rest or do Laundry!) |
1:15-3:00pm | Acting/Scene Study or Improvisation/Imagination |
3:15-5:00pm | Acting/Scene Study or Improvisation/Imagination |
5:00-7:00pm | Evening Classes. Students will participate in a wide variety of activities including workshops (Playwriting, Chekhov, Shakespeare, Mask, and Stage Combat), Given Circumstances with John Astin, Staged Readings and Talk-Backs and rehearsals. |
10:00-11:00pm | Free time, Homework and Lights Out! |
